Abstract

Two binuclear bis(tricarbonyliron) title complexes with N~2~Fe~2~ tetrahedral cores, 1 and 2, respectively, which show different molecular folding resulting from the appearance (in 1), and absence (in 2) of the NN σ‐bond, were compared in terms of mass spectral fragmentation routes. A multipath fragmentation noted for the molecule 1 revealing internal stress contrasts with the single‐route fragmentation of 2. The fragmentation paths resulting from the admixtures were defined and analyzed from the fragment ion B/E and parent ion B^2^/E linked scan spectra. Copyright © 2002 John Wiley & Sons, Ltd.
